Remarks. Harnischia ohmuraensis Kobayashi & Suzuki, 1999 , H. sibabecea Sasa, Sumita & Suzuki, 1999 , H. minuta Dutta & Chaudhuri, 1996 and H. tenuitubercula Chaudhuri & Chattopadhyay, 1990 have medially setose anal tergite, long gonostylus, broad anal point, and very small superior volsella. Kobayashi & Endo (2008) have synonymised H. sibabecea Sasa, Sumita & Suzuki, 1999 with H. ohmuraensis Kobayashi & Suzuki, 1999 . Besides that, Chen et al. (2017) mentioned that H. tenuitubercula Chaudhuri & Chattopadhyay, 1990 and H. ohmuraensis Kobayashi & Suzuki, 1999 may be conspecific. After a considerate study of types, we come to conclusion that H. minuta Dutta & Chaudhuri, 1996 is also conspecific with H. sibabecea Sasa, Sumita & Suzuki, 1999 . The original description of H. tenuitubercula was published in 1990 while descriptions of other species were made on 1996 and 1999 respectively. Therefore, the species H. minuta , H. ohmuraensis and H. sibabecea are junior synonyms of H. tenuitubercula .

A world key to the species of the genus Harnischia Kieffer View in CoL (male)

(Modified after Chen et al., 2017)

1. Posterior margin of tergite IX concave at basal part of anal point (Palaearctic)...... H. quadricincta ( Goetghebuer, 1934b) View in CoL

- Posterior margin of tergite IX not concave at basal region of anal point......................................... 2

2(1). Gonostylus short and broad............................................................................ 3

- Gonostylus long and roughly narrow................................................................... 14

3(2). Gonostylus with tooth-like or sharp projection at apex....................................................... 4

- Gonostylus without sharp projection..................................................................... 5

4(3). Gonocoxite with well-developed protuberance on distal inner margin; gonostylus with two bayonet-shaped projections (Palaearctic)..................................................................... H. cultriata Wang, 1999 View in CoL

- Gonocoxite without protuberance on inner margin; gonostylus with an inner apical tooth (Palaearctic and Orient)............................................................................. H. angularis Albu & Botnariuc, 1966 View in CoL

5(3). Gonostylus with inner basal expansion................................................................... 6

- Gonostylus without inner basal expansion................................................................ 8

6(5). Gonostylus with a strong bulbous-like inner expansion (Orient)..................... H. turgidula Wang & Jheng, 1993 View in CoL

- Gonostylus with weak inner expansion................................................................... 7

7(6). Anal point tapering, apex sharp (Orient, Palaearctic).................................. H. fuscimana Kieffer, 1921c View in CoL

- Anal point parallel-sided, blunt and rounded apex (Palaearctic)....................... H. parallela Yan & Wang, 2016 View in CoL

8(5). Gonostylus expanded apically......................................................................... 9

- Gonostylus parallel-sided........................................................................... 10

9(8). Anal point tapered from base to apex; gonostylus with a little distal expansion (Palaearctic).................................................................................. H. biwacurtus Kawai, Okamoto & Imabayashi, 2002 View in CoL

- Anal point expanded in distal 1/3; gonostylus without a projection on distal part (Palaerctic).................................................................................................... H. japonica Hashimoto, 1984 View in CoL

10(8). Anal tergite band V shaped........................................................................... 11

- Anal tergite band Y shaped........................................................................... 12

11(10). Gonostylus highly curved in middle; anal point moderately long and broad (Orient, Holarctic, Australasia, Afrotropics)............................................................................ H. curtilamellata (Malloch, 1915) View in CoL

- Gonostylus straight; anal point nearly short (Oriental China).................. H. longispuria Wang, Ji & Zheng, 1993 View in CoL

12(10). Anal point with pointed apex (Palaearctic)........................................... H. hachijoprima Sasa, 1994 View in CoL

- Anal point with blunt apex........................................................................... 13

13(12). Anal point tapered from base to apex (Palaearctic)........................... H. dissecta Zhang & Ferrington, 2017

- Anal point slender at base and wide in middle (Palaeartic)................... H. inaefeus Sasa, Kitami & Suzuki, 2001

14(2). Anal point very broad and long (Orient)........................ H. tenuitubercula Chaudhuri & Chattopadhyay, 1990 View in CoL

- Anal point moderately narrow in shape.................................................................. 15

15(14). Small lobe-like appearance lateral to anal point (Orient)........................................ H. bulbosa View in CoL sp.n.

- Anal point without lateral lobe-like structure............................................................. 16

16(15). Anal point parallel in shape with blunt apex (Afrotropics)............................ H. lacteiforceps Kieffer, 1923 View in CoL

- Anal point constricted in middle with sharp pointed apex (Orient, Nearctic)................. H. incidata Townes, 1945 View in CoL
